Benzonitrile itself is an aromatic nitrile, a molecule characterized by a phenyl group bonded to a nitrile functional group (-C≡N). This fundamental structure can be further functionalized, leading to a vast array of derivatives with diverse chemical properties and applications. The presence of a nitrile group often imparts reactivity that is highly useful in organic synthesis, allowing for transformations into amines, amides, carboxylic acids, and other crucial functional groups found in many APIs.
4-(4-Bromo-3-(Hydroxymethyl)Phenoxy)Benzonitrile is a sophisticated example, featuring a bromine atom, a hydroxymethyl group, and a phenoxy linkage attached to the benzonitrile core. Each of these functional groups contributes specific reactivity and structural characteristics, making it an ideal intermediate for complex synthesis pathways. The bromine atom, for instance, can readily participate in cross-coupling reactions, a cornerstone of modern organic synthesis for forming carbon-carbon bonds. The hydroxymethyl group offers a site for further esterification, etherification, or oxidation reactions.
